CARES is a College of Agriculture, Food and Natural Resources center at the University of Missouri - Columbia. CARES is located in Mumford Hall in the Memorial Union area of the Columbia campus. For location and driving directions, see location.
While we are housed in the east wing of historic Mumford Hall, constructed in 1922, our facilities have been renovated to incorporate modern office standards, including climate control, network access, lighting and energy-efficient windows. CARES proudly occupies the offices originally constructed for the Dean of Agriculture and his support staff.
Hardware includes more than fifty Windows-based PCs and servers. All workstations are Ethernet networked and have full Internet access. CARES has 14 terabytes (14,000 gigabytes) of combined disk storage, a 2.4TB capacity tape archive and backup system, and the ability to print E-size documents. More details on hardware...
Software includes Microsoft SQL Server 2005, ArcGIS 9.3, ArcIMS 9.3, ArcGIS Server 9.3 as well as several other economic and environmental modeling packages. Operating systems include Windows XP Pro and Windows Server 2003. More details on software...
CARES Internet capacity includes five servers, four development servers, web hosting for other campus centers, and Internet mapping capacity. We serve a large number of geographic databases on the web, including Digital Orthophoto Quarter Quadrangles (DOQQs) for the entire state of Missouri. More details on our web servers...
